Four weeks can be effective for focused ACT preparation, especially if you're already familiar with the test format and looking to refine your skills. The key is intensive, targeted study—working through practice tests, identifying your weakest sections, and drilling those areas repeatedly. Students who combine a structured 4-week prep plan with consistent daily practice often see meaningful score improvements. However, your starting point matters; if you're beginning from scratch, a longer timeline may help you build foundational skills more thoroughly.

The Reading section typically requires the most time to improve because it demands both speed and comprehension—skills that take practice to develop. Math can improve quickly if you focus on specific problem types you struggle with, while English and Science are often more responsive to targeted strategy work. In a 4-week program, you'll likely see the fastest gains in sections where you can identify and fix specific weaknesses (like particular grammar rules or science question formats) rather than sections requiring broader skill development.

Aim for at least 3-4 full practice tests over four weeks—roughly one per week—plus targeted section practice on days between full tests. This schedule gives you time to take a test under timed conditions, review your mistakes thoroughly, and drill weak areas before your next full practice. Quality matters more than quantity; spending an hour reviewing one test is more valuable than rushing through multiple tests without analysis. Your tutor can help you prioritize which practice tests to take and how to extract maximum learning from each one.

Pacing is one of the biggest challenges on the ACT, especially for Reading and Science where time pressure is intense. A 4-week prep program focuses heavily on timing strategies—like skimming vs. reading carefully, knowing when to skip a question and come back, and practicing with a timer until pacing becomes automatic. The goal isn't to answer every question perfectly; it's to maximize your score by spending time wisely on questions you can get right. Regular timed practice is essential to building this skill.
